Trojans score low in second place finish

Published 8:02 pm Thursday, April 18, 2019

The Charles Henderson golf team hosted and competed in a match at the Troy Country Club on Thursday.

The match marked the third time that the Trojans hosted a match at the Country Club and Thursday they had their best performance.

As a team, the Trojans finished in second place after shooting 320. The Trojans finished behind top finisher Andalusia, who fired off a 309 as a team. Northview finished in third place with a score of 328 and Eufaula finished in fourth with a 368.

“I was really proud of the guys,” said head coach Doug Branson. “I thought as a team that is as good as we have shot. We had one guy in the 70s and three guys in the 80s. We were playing at home and that is a positive, but I’m really proud of the effort today.”

Griff McCrary led the Trojans by shooting a 76, good enough for third-best in the tournament behind Andalusia’s top scorers, who shot a 71 and a 73.

Braden Prestwood finished with an 80, while Brady Barron shot an 81. Cody Paramore finished with an 83 and Grant Baker fired off a 94.

With two regular season matches remaining, Branson is starting to see his team live up to their potential.

“At the beginning of the year, I really thought we had a chance for guys to be able to score like we are scoring now. It’s taken us the majority of the year to get going. We are finally starting to get close to our potential. We have gotten better as the year has gone on and we have gotten more consistent. Our number one and two are starting to get really confident with themselves. The best part of our team is that the three, four and five hole guys, we are starting to get those guys into the 80s consistently.”

The Trojans will close out the regular with two matches on Tuesday and Thursday at the Troy Country Club. They will head to sectionals in Mobile on Monday.
